Definition Infinite tensor products [efr-SIKM]
Let \mathcal {C} be a semiCartesian symmetric monoidal category and let \{X_j\}_{j \in J} be a family of objects. Then if P_f(J) denotes the set of finite subsets of J (ordered by inclusion), we obtain a diagram P_f(J)^\mathrm {op} \to \mathcal {C}, where F \mapsto \bigotimes _{j \in F} X_j, and the inclusion F \to F' is mapped to the morphism which applies the deletion X_j \to I for every j not in F.
An infinite tensor product of the collection \{X_j\} is a limit of the cofiltered diagram F \mapsto \bigotimes _{j \in F} X_j, if it exists and is preserved by the tensor Y \otimes - for every Y \in \mathcal {C}.
